Chemotherapy and mesothelioma radiation are typical treatments used for many types of cancer, including mesothelioma. However, the Japan Journal of Clinical Oncology reported in 1998 that a 71-year old woman with peritoneal mesothelioma was given cisplatin and tegafur-uracil, two common chemotherapy drugs. This caused the patient to go into complete remission.
Adjuvant radiation therapy, which is a therapy applied after mesothelioma surgery, helps to reduce the recurrence of cancer, according to a study held at Sloan-Kettering. The type of radiation therapy often used is known as EBRT, or External beam radiation therapy.
